ο»Ώ47 9235 Mcbride Street, Langley, BC

4 Bed | 3 Full Bath | 1 Half Bath | Sqr Footage 3291sq.ft


Welcome to sought-after McBride Station. Rarely available, almost 3,300 sq ft (largest floor plan), located in a quiet part of the complex with a fenced, south-facing yard backing on designated green space. Extremely private! Features 4 bedrooms with master on the main, a custom glass walled office, air-conditioning, great room with coffered ceilings, custom millwork, and a large island. Upstairs has a spacious loft, custom built-in bed/nook area and a second bedroom with vaulted ceilings. Full basement features a home gym with Nike grind flooring and mirrored wall, large bar kitchen, games and entertainment room. Plenty of storage. Big house amenities with a low maintenance lifestyle. Miles of walking trails from the back gate. Fantastic location, steps to great eateries & all amenities.
